Lamorgese urged to explain police baton charge of students

Rome student files complaint after being hit by cops at Pantheon

ROME, 24 January 2022, 15:55

Interior Minister Luciana Lamorgese was urged Monday to explain why police had baton-charged a student demonstration in Rome Sunday protesting the death of a student in Friuli on his last day of work experience Friday.
    Ismaele Calaciura Errante, an 18-year-old student, said he was "struck without having done anything" as police stopped the demo approaching parliament near the central Pantheon temple.
    "I'm going to file a complaint now, I was afraid yesterday".
    Centre left Democratic Party (PD) MP Matteo Orfini said "in Rome the students demonstrating after the death of Lorenzo Parelli were baton-charged by the police and bashed with truncheons for no reason.
    "In the same city the fascists of Forza Nuova were allowed to assault the HQ of (leftwing trade union) CGIL. Minister Lamorgese, does that seem normal?".
    Communist Refoundation (PRC) national committee member Giovanni Barbera "Minister Lamorgese must clear up what happened," saying that the media had portrayed the protest at the Pantheon as anti-capitalists and anarchists, "as if to justify the disgraceful baton charges of the police".
